Enphase Unveils IQ Battery 5P for Smarter Home Power
🕓 Estimated Reading Time: 5 minutes
Overview
Enphase Energy, Inc. (NASDAQ: ENPH), a global leader in microinverter-based solar and battery systems, has announced the launch of its next-generation battery system, the Enphase IQ Battery 5P. This new residential energy storage solution is designed to offer significantly higher power and enhanced reliability, aiming to provide homeowners with a more robust and responsive power backup and energy management system. The unveiling marks a pivotal moment in the company's trajectory, reinforcing its commitment to advancing smart, sustainable energy solutions for residential applications worldwide. The IQ Battery 5P is engineered to meet the increasing demand for energy independence and grid resilience, particularly in regions prone to power outages or with volatile energy pricing.

The new battery system boasts a modular design, allowing for flexible capacity configurations to suit diverse household energy needs. With a focus on performance, the IQ Battery 5P delivers substantially more power output than its predecessors, translating into quicker energy response times and improved support for high-demand appliances during grid disruptions. Its integrated design and simplified installation process are also key highlights, aiming to streamline the adoption of advanced home energy solutions for installers and consumers alike. Implications & Analysis
The Enphase IQ Battery 5P represents a substantial upgrade in residential energy storage capabilities. One of its most striking features is its enhanced power output, reportedly double that of previous Enphase models. This elevated power rating allows the system to support a wider array of household appliances simultaneously during a grid outage, providing homeowners with greater comfort and utility. The modular architecture, a hallmark of Enphase's approach, means that the system can be easily expanded or scaled down based on specific energy consumption patterns and future needs, offering remarkable flexibility for consumers and installers.

Furthermore, the IQ Battery 5P incorporates lithium iron phosphate (LFP) battery chemistry. This choice is significant, as LFP batteries are widely recognized for their enhanced safety, longer cycle life, and thermal stability compared to other lithium-ion chemistries. This commitment to safety and longevity is crucial for residential installations, where reliability is paramount. The system's integration with the Enphase IQ System, which includes IQ microinverters and the IQ Gateway, ensures a cohesive and intelligent energy management experience. Homeowners can monitor their energy production and consumption in real-time through the Enphase App, optimizing their energy usage for savings and sustainability. The streamlined commissioning process for the new solar battery system is also expected to reduce installation times and costs for certified installers, accelerating the deployment of these advanced solutions across residential markets globally.
